Raminder is a plastic and reconstructive surgeon based in Melbourne, Australia.

He currently holds positions as a consultant specialist in plastic and reconstructive surgery at Peter MacCallum Cancer Centre, Austin Hospital and Eastern Health in Melbourne and has private consulting rooms in Lower Templestowe.

Raminder graduated from the University of Otago in New Zealand and went on to specialise in the field of Plastic and Reconstructive surgery where he trained in NZ and Melbourne. Raminder was a recipient of the Australian and NZ Society of Plastic Surgeons (ASPS/NZAPS) Plastic and Reconstructive Surgical Award and the Royal Australasian College of Surgeons (RACS) Foundation for Surgery Research Scholarship.

He completed a Microsurgery Research Fellowship in 2010 at The Bernard O’Brien Institute of Microsurgery and is a Fellow of the Royal Australasian College of Surgeons.

Raminder's passion is to restore form and function by performing plastic and reconstructive surgery of the face, hand and body. He is actively involved in volunteer plastic surgery through Interplast.
